Job Description
The Senior Program Manager will be responsible for managing large-scale, highly complex, multi-faceted, new product development programs, strategic initiatives or integrations involving internal and external development partners. All projects and programs will involve leading fully cross-functional and global core teams with both internal and external team members.
The Sr. Program Manager is responsible for the planning of all program subsystem and project deliverables, synchronization, and prioritization of Core Team activities. The Sr. Program Manager is responsible for directly and indirectly driving program execution and all development efforts (internal and external) while ensuring that all program deliverables and efforts are connected and meet internal and external customer requirements and follow OSTA’s (Olympus Surgical Technologies of America) Product Development Process (PDP), including communicating various progress reports and reviews with senior leadership.
For Sr. Program Manager with PM supervisory responsibilities, provide Project Execution Leadership for assigned portfolio of initiatives by establishing and maintaining cross functional organizational alignment, informing the ExCom, PAB, BU Leaders, Sales Business Unit and Olympus Tokyo stakeholders on all relevant project matters when required. Responsible for the recruitment and continuous development of PMs, managing PM escalations, ensure appropriate project resourcing, represent PMO in associated Business Unit communication meetings for the areas of responsibility when required and support PDD for NPD on achieving business strategic goals
Job Duties
Plan and execute highly complex, large-scale internal and external new product development programs (made up of multiple cross-functional projects with distinct goals)
Lead the Core Team in the development of a project charter, objectives, project plan and schedule for assigned program
Develop and manage budgets for the program including resource loading, external expenses, and capital requirements
Proactively identify and assess areas of risk, escalate issues in a timely manner, and collaboratively develop and deploy solutions. Proactively assess program health and identify opportunities for project change; implement and manage changes and interventions to achieve timely project outputs. Proactively manage project-related actions and deliverables, holding team members and functional managers accountable for completion
Create, align, and provide regular project updates (written and verbal) to appropriate stakeholders and relevant management board; create presentations, dashboards, and executive summaries – both scheduled and ad hoc
Conduct highly effective cross-functional team meetings to ensure accountability and milestone achievements; create agendas and publish minutes/actions
Build team ownership and commitment to project and business plans and define project milestones, deliverables, and associated resource requirements
Actively lead cross-functional project teams (and external partners) through planning and execution, providing direction, guidance, coaching and mentoring for Core Team members when needed; prioritizes activities for team
Proactively manage performance issues and conflicts within project team; work to resolve these issues in alignment with functional management
Provide input to functional leaders on team member performance and functional management support
Cultivate a team culture of continuous improvement and teamwork that strives to improve in quality, safety, delivery, and cost
Actively build and foster collaborative relationships across all levels of internal stakeholders and external partners to improve overall outcomes and timely project execution
Gain collaboration, cooperation, and commitment from people through influence, rather than authority
May lead functional excellence initiatives
Lead early-stage business case development and planning efforts of a program; includes gathering customer input and defining user requirements. Define early-stage estimates of schedule, budget, and resources for a program; align estimates with functional leaders
May act as a program portfolio manager for a business unit, partnering with leadership to define priority and manage program conflict
Other essential duties as directed
Job Qualifications
Required:
BS degree in engineering or technical field required; MS or MBA preferred
Minimum of 5 years of Class 2 medical device industry experience in the medical device field
Minimum of 8 years of experience preferably in a R&D, engineering, or project management role, interfacing with new product development
Minimum of 6 years of successful demonstrated experience in managing large technically complex new product development programs
Experience with applicable FDA guidance, ISO 13485 regulations, and applicable industry standards
Master-level user of Microsoft Project; expertly proficient in Excel, Power Point, Visio, and Word
Formal training in project management completed; PMP certification required
Position requires up to 20% domestic & 5% international travel

About us:
Our Medical business uses innovative capabilities in medical technology, therapeutic intervention, and precision manufacturing to help healthcare professionals deliver diagnostic, therapeutic, and minimally invasive procedures to improve clinical outcomes, reduce costs, and enhance the quality of life for patients and their safety.
Headquartered in Tokyo, Japan, Olympus employs more than 31,000 employees worldwide in nearly 40 countries and regions. Olympus Corporation of the Americas, a wholly owned subsidiary of Olympus Corporation, is headquartered in Center Valley, Pennsylvania, USA, and employs more than 5,200 employees throughout locations in North and South America.
